Mytilini, Lesbos vs Kerkira Climate & Distance Between

Greece flag
  • The distance between Mytilini, Lesbos, Greece and Kerkira, Greece is approximately 573 km or 356 mi.
  • To reach Mytilini, Lesbos in this distance one would set out from Kerkira bearing 93.6°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Mytilini, Lesbos bearing 97.9° or E .
  • Both have a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• The average annual temperature is 0.3 °C (0.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.2 °C (0.4°F) more in Mytilini, Lesbos.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 348.3 mm (13.7 in) less which is equivalent to 348.3 l/m² (8.55 US gal/ft²) or 3,483,000 l/ha (372,356 US gal/ac) less. About 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.5° higher in Mytilini, Lesbos than in Kerkira.
  • Relative humidity levels are 14.2%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 3.2°C (5.7°F) lower.
